Output 6d50509c859812b0b4874225d1c13274c354721c6328c8ddb868c2ee64b6ccaf:0

value
121820940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b986972b92da68f40b3ae8061e1be24a8ed0b4 OP_EQUALVERIFY OP_CHECKSIG
address
17B6XQdFxnP7rhh5nfxKpLyyxLY3hRVKDB
transaction
6d50509c859812b0b4874225d1c13274c354721c6328c8ddb868c2ee64b6ccaf
confirmations
444701
spent
true